The cost of halls in Haringey averages around £125 hire fee per hour. The final price will depend on location, size, amenities, and demand. Some venues also offer additional packages that include catering, AV equipment, or additional services. Take a look at the usual price ranges in Haringey, based on Tagvenue data:
From £60 | to £200 | hire fee per hour |
From £160 | to £2995 | minimum spend per event |
From £4500 | hire fee per day |

This is an incredibly beautiful and posh neighbourhood in North London. You’ll find the most options for hall hire in Wood Green, near Alexandra Palace train station. Other venues perfect for large weddings, banquets and conferences are located west of Tottenham Hale station close to the A10 roadway, making the area easy to reach both from within and outside London.
